Travelore News: Airberlin Announces Business Class Sale For Summer Travel As Low As $3,649 From New York (JFK) To Germany



airberlin has launched a business class sale for those travelers looking to fly in style and comfort. The sale includes fares starting from as low as $3,649.00 including all taxes and surcharges from New York (JFK) to Germany for example and also covers other premiere destinations such as Copenhagen, Milan, Vienna and Zurich at slightly higher rates.

Germany’s second largest airline recently completed the refurbishment of its Business Class on its long haul fleet which now features FullFlat seats with a massage function, USB port, personal entertainment system featuring a 15-inch monitor and gourmet culinary selections. And as a member of oneworld®, airberlin guests can take advantage of accruing and redeeming miles on any oneworld partner airline in addition to airberlin. The sale will run through July 8th, 2014 and travel period is valid from July 1st through August 31, 2014.

airberlin is one of the leading airlines in Europe and flies to 171 destinations worldwide each year. The second largest airline in Germany carried more than 31.5 million passengers in 2013. airberlin offers a global route network through its strategic partnership with Etihad Airways, which has a 29.21% share in airberlin, and through membership of the oneworld airline alliance. The airline with the award-winning service operates codeshare flights worldwide with
17 airlines. The fleet has an average age of five years and is among the most modern and eco-efficient in Europe.
